| By the end of 2019,the total mileage of expressways in China has reached 149600 km,ranking first in the world.Expressway auxiliary mechanical and electrical system is one of the important components of expressway,and it is an important guarantee facility to reflect the function,safety and service attributes of expressway.With the rapid expansion of Expressway Mechanical and electrical system,mechanical and electrical maintenance is becoming more and more important.It will gradually develop from a subdivision business of expressway operation to one of the core business.In addition,the electromechanical system should be improved with the times The technology and management level of unified maintenance is also imminent.To sum up,it is of practical significance to carry out the research on the maintenance quality evaluation of expressway electromechanical system at this stage.This paper takes the construction of "index system of influencing Expressway Mechanical and electrical system maintenance quality" as the goal,chooses the research idea of "value engineering theory(VE)" combined with "analytic hierarchy process(AHP)",and takes into account the structural characteristics of expressway electromechanical system and the related requirements of electromechanical maintenance technology and management.Firstly,the index system is constructed and the index weight is calculated Then,the case study is carried out based on the index system.The main research contents and conclusions are summarized as follows:(1)In order to make the index system more complete and reasonable,the paper revised and improved the index system by questionnaire survey,and then calculated the weight of the final index system.(2)In this paper,the factors that affect the maintenance quality of Expressway Mechanical and electrical system are mainly determined as "function" index,and "cost" index is used to directly obtain the occurred data through later evaluation,and then the value of maintenance quality is calculated by combining "function" and "cost" indexes with value engineering theory.(3)This paper gives the value definition of quantitative calculation or qualitative description for each index in the index system,and forms a systematic theoretical system for evaluating the mechanical and electrical maintenance quality of expressways.(4)Finally,the paper selects the Xinjiang Hami Expressway to carry out the case application analysis.The case application shows that the research results can effectively select the best scheme of new technology and equipment selection required by mechanical and electrical maintenance,and it also helps the highway operation unit to compare and select the most appropriate maintenance mode.The innovation of this paper lies in the selection of value engineering,which divides the factors affecting the maintenance quality into two dimensions of "function" and "cost",which is different from the traditional fixed thinking of cost oriented evaluation.Therefore,the significance of research based on value engineering is to obtain the optimal maintenance quality with reasonable(or lowest)cost.The conclusion of the paper also verifies the reasonable integrity of the index system and the significance of production guidance,and the results are expected to provide reference for the related research of Expressway Mechanical and electrical system maintenance. |
